ALL WORLD TWO: 1936. 0-V-1 battery, headphones. 15-52 metres with the two coils supplied (others extra).
Probably the �Cinderella� of Stratton in the late �30s, the A.W.2 is described in E.S.W.M. No.3 (ibid.), offered as a kit (price
�3 7s 6d plus valves and case) or ready-built and tested for �5 5s complete.
It continued in the shops until the outbreak of World War 2, by which time its price (ready-built)
had fallen to �3 17s 6d. To tempt new impecunious S.W.L.s it was offered on Hire Purchase terms complete with phones
and batteries for �1 down and six monthly payments of 16s 4d. (The starting pay for an office boy at this time was around 5s weekly).
All World Two 1936-39. A mains hybrid was described (heater transformer, HT battery) but never mentioned again.
Used by Voluntary Interceptors (V.I.s) during the early war period, before H.R.O.s were bought from U.S.A.
(V.I.s were civilian hams and S.W.L.s who monitored enemy Morse signals from their home QTH for Bletchley Park cipher school to decode.)
(from EddystoneUserGroup QRG)
An early set here, 1932 ish. The All Wave Four.
Stratton & Co.Ltd.; Birmingham. TRF with reaction (regenerative).
Coverage 150 kHz - 24 MHz (2,5" vertical plug in coils: blue coil 13-26m, yellow 22-45m, red 40-85 m,green 250-500m),
Igranic Indigraph dials, aerial tuning coupling condensor;
tropicalised diecast sectionalised aluminium case with hinged cover.
Eddystones' earliest "professional grade" model successfully used by British Arctic Air Route Expedition 1930.

The 358 with plug in coils
Coverage 40 kHz - 31MHz in 10 bands. Wave band is changed by plugging in different coil units.
No crystal filter, note the lacking switch left of "tone" and "BFO" controls (see 358X with crystal filter).
Matching external Power supply S390 supplying 6V LT and 175/180V HT. Army tube designations: ARP34 ARTH2 ARP34 ARP34
AR21 ARP34 VT52 ZA3489. Navy designation Receiver B34.

The four band S-670 receiver, general coverage.
Year: 1948�1954. UAF41 UCH41 UAF41 UAF41 UAF41 UL41 UL41. Receiver used as "cabin set" on board of ships
for first class passengers and ship's officers; Coverage 522 kHz - 30 MHz in four bands (522-1220 kHz; 1,2-2,75 MHz;
3,7-10,6 MHz; 10,5-30 MHz, not the gap in the range of maritime communications bands), AM only.In many sets, spare
dials made for the 659 receiver have been used (mediumwaves marked in meters), the dial back-plate carried
the designation "Marine Receiver 659/670" in the same place of the magic eye.

The 680x general coverage hf receiver.
Frequency Coverage :- 480 kc/s to 30 Mc/s in 5 ranges.
Range 1 : - 30 to 12.3 Mc/s.
Range 2 : - 12.5 to 5.3 Mc/s.
Range 3 : - 5.7 to 2.5 Mc/s.
Range 4 : - 2.5 to 1.11 Mc/s.
Range 5 : - 1120 kc/s to 480 kc/s.
The intermediate frequency was permeability tuned to 450kc/s, the coupling between the coils being varied mechanically by a panel
control to give a wide range of selectivity. The BFO had a range of plus or minus 3 kc/s. Aerial Input : - 400 ohm (nominal).
Power Supply : - 100 and 200-250 volts AC (40 to 60 c/s).

The 730/4 general coverage set, used by the military.
The receiver is a 15 valve superhet, having 2 RF stages. It uses 7 and 9 pin miniature valves throughout, apart from the rectifier
and voltage regulator, which are octal. The set is designed to work off mains power or batteries. Sensitivity is given as AM better than
5uv, CW better than 2uv at 15db S/N at 50 mw output power. Power output at 1 watt into 2.5 ohms gives typically 18% distortion.
Cathode follower output is at 68 ohms. There are 5 tuning ranges as follows: Range 1 12.3 - 30 MHz Range 2 5.3 - 12.5 MHz Range 3 2.8 - 5.3 MHz
Range 4 1.1 - 2.5 MHz Range 5 0.43 - 1.1 MHz. The intermediate frequency is 450kc/s.

the LW/MW/VHF 820 Tuner, supplied to be fitted into ones own hifi unit .....
Year: 1955. 6AM6 12AT7 ECH42 6AM6 EM80 6AM6 6AL5 EZ41. FM broadcast band tuner covering 87.5 - 100 MHz, two MW presets
(one in 610-960 and one in 960-1550 kHz range - BBC Home and Light) and one LW preset (one in 150 - 250 kHz range - BBC Droitwich Light).
Output only low level for HiFi amplifier. Also sold as Mimco 2294A (9 sets) and with crystal control for Rediffusion.

The model 840 receiver.
Only 501 manufactured. EDDYSTONE TYPE S.840: �Economy�communications receiver suggested by Stratton�s agent in the British Dependency of Aden
on the Persian Gulf. They were selling lots of the very successful 670 �cabin� broadcast receivers and suggested that a similar set but with a
BFO for SWLs would be a good seller. And so the 840 was created. The whole series (840A/840C � ibid.) ran for 15 years and was a great
success. 7 valves; 1 RF; 1 IF (450kc/s) BFO; AC/DC 110-250v (work anywhere!) 4 bands, 480kc/s-30mc/s.

The 850 VLF rx..............
Year: 1961/1962. 6BA6 6AJ8 6BA6 6BA6 6AL5 6AU6 6AT6 6AM5 6BE6 5Z4G VR150-30. VLF communications receiver covering 10 - 600 kHz in 6 bands
(10-20, 19-40, 40-85, 80-160, 150-310, 300 - 600 kHz), AM, CW (BFO). S-meter, CW audio filter, bandwidth 0,4 / 1,5 / 6 kHz.
Used for maritime and submarine communications surveillance, 100 sets produced. Aerial input 75 and 300 Ohm, balanced or unbalanced.
Connection for IF output abt. 100 mV suitable for terminating impedances 75-300 Ohm.
Audio output: loudspeaker 2,5-3 Ohm, lines 600 Ohm, headphone 2000 Ohm.
